How Dangerous Is Blister From CAPSAICIN?

Of the 38 reports, 6 (15.8%) required hospitalization, and 2 (5.3%) were considered life-threatening.

Is Blister Listed in the Official Label?

Yes, Blister is listed as a known adverse reaction in the official FDA drug label for CAPSAICIN.
